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 3 Dormitorios en New Berlin

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en New Berlin?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en New Berlin está en Stratton Oaks listado en $999.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en New Berlin?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en New Berlin es $1,803.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en New Berlin 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en New Berlin es una unidad de 2,241 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,267 en The Willows at Kendall Brook.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en New Berlin?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en New Berlin es actualmente de 1,561 pies cuadrados.
